![]() LMFAO to the poor suckers who put money into these gimmicks. Close to 200 machines up and operational. You put your money in and choose between 2 "skill" games. Once you choose it automatically goes to close to max credits, so you have to scale down your amount. Then, once you hit play it spins the three reels. Once the three reels stop, you have to "nudge" one line up or down. They are 5 cent machine with a minimum bet of 5 credits, hence a 25 cent spin. poor payouts, etc etc.. Word has it they are tight, tight. Plus they look ancient but the one good thing is they make no noise.
